Repairs to UPVC windows

uPVC windows are a common choice for homeowners due to the fact that they are energy-efficient, durable and require little maintenance. However, as with all windows of this type, uPVC windows can experience issues in time. Fortunately, professional repair services can address these issues and restore the functionality of the window.

Upvc window repairs near me window repair could include replacing broken frames, sills and sashes. They can also include replacing damaged or cracked glass. Repair services can ensure that your UPVC window is energy efficient and secure. You can also reduce your energy bills by reducing drafts in your house.

Condensation on the interior surface of uPVC window frames is a frequent issue. This problem is often caused by airflow and temperature difference between the outdoor and indoor environment. This issue could be caused by a number of factors, including dirt or debris on the window tracks, as well as the misalignment of. This is a difficult issue to fix, especially during colder weather.

Another issue that is common to UPVC windows is the possibility of leaks. These leaks are usually caused by damaged hardware, misaligned sashes or damaged seals. It is essential to address these issues as soon as possible in order to avoid water damage and other problems. Fortunately, professional UPVC repair services can identify the problem and fix it quickly and quickly.

Apart from these issues, UPVC windows can also develop cracks or scratches. Minor damage to the frame or beading can be repaired, while major damage requires replacement. Fortunately, UPVC services can make the process as simple and affordable as it is.

UPVC door repairs

uPVC front doors are a very common type of door used in homes. They are generally less expensive than composite doors and offer the best security. However, as with all kinds of doors, they are susceptible to damage and require maintenance. This can be anything from fixing a damaged lock to replacing the whole door. It is crucial to fix your uPVC doors immediately when they exhibit signs of wear. This will ensure that your home is safe and the door is easy to open and close.

The majority of uPVC doors are repairable, provided you have the correct tools and materials. For instance, if your uPVC door has a small hole or dent it can be repaired using an easy filler like wood putty or bondo (auto body repair material). This will help to restore the original shape of the panel, and leave it in good shape. However, if the issue is more significant or complex, it's a good idea to seek out a professional uPVC door repair service.

The door handle is another frequent uPVC issue. This can be due to the uPVC hinges of the door becoming misaligned over time. The key to this is to use an oil-based lubricant for the hinges and rollers to keep them running smoothly. A silicon-based lubricant is the best since it won't draw dirt and debris that could cause the hinges to be misaligned.

Lubricating your uPVC multi-point locks is as important as lubricating your uPVC hinges.
